From: Oleg Zadorozhnyi =0A= =0A= Register each of the four on-chip PLLs as a DPLL device and the clocks=0A= around them as pins: the inputs, the crystal, and the outputs the loaded=0A= configuration routes to a PLL. An output routed to no PLL gets no pin,=0A= since there would be nothing for the core to report about it.=0A= =0A= The callbacks a device needs from the start come with it -- lock status=0A= and the operating mode -- along with the direction of each pin. The rest= =0A= of the pin operations follow in later patches.=0A= =0A= Both need somewhere to read from. The chip reports its state across=0A= several pages, and a netlink call must not turn into a burst of I2C=0A= transactions, so a kthread worker polls the interesting registers twice a= =0A= second into a per-input, per-output and per-PLL cache, and the callbacks=0A= answer from it. The same tick compares the new state against the old and= =0A= notifies the core only on a change.
